Cursive Urmib 4 is a regular weight, very narrow, very high contrast, upright, short x-height font.

This script has a tall, slender silhouette with dramatic thick–thin modulation that mimics a pointed brush or flexible nib. Strokes are clean and upright-leaning, with long ascenders and descenders, frequent looped constructions, and occasional swash-like terminals and entry strokes. The rhythm alternates between compact joins and extended, tapered hairlines, creating a lively texture; counters stay relatively open while some letters feature pronounced vertical stems and narrow internal spaces. Numerals follow the same calligraphic logic, with tapered ends and varying stroke emphasis rather than monoline geometry.

This font suits branding marks, boutique packaging, invitations, and short headline phrases where a refined handwritten look is desirable. It works particularly well for beauty, lifestyle, and wedding-adjacent design, and for social graphics that benefit from expressive, high-contrast lettering.

The overall tone is graceful and fashion-forward, balancing polished calligraphy with an informal handwritten energy. Its thin hairlines and sweeping joins feel light and airy, while the bold downstrokes add drama and a sense of occasion.

The design appears intended to emulate modern calligraphy made with a brush pen, combining strong downstrokes with delicate hairlines and fluid connections. It prioritizes expressive word shapes and decorative capitals for display-oriented typography over uniform text texture.

Capital forms are especially decorative, with flourish-prone strokes that stand out at the start of words. Spacing and stroke contrast make it visually striking at larger sizes, where the delicate connecting strokes and terminal flicks remain clear.
